3. Style sheet
The colors within ”we need to talk about kevin.” is
used to convey a disturbing scenario without having
any disturbing scenarios. For example the plain white
represents the empty dry emotion of Kevin as well as
his mother Eva after the incident. This also portrays
Kevin and Eva's loveless relationship. What makes this
disturbing is the use of red. With the plain white
highly saturated colours enhance the violent red
throughout the movie. As red is mostly situated with
negativity, rage or alarms. For this film however it is
related with blood. With the lack of gore and blood
within the film, director Lynne Ramsey states
the colour red makes sure that the idea of blood
constantly remains in the audience's mind. For my
project, ide love to master this effect in order to make
my movie seem dark without using dark colour
grading. I want my project to emphasize my
protagonists mindset and his dark uncontrollable
need to get rid of people who disturb him. I could
even use the colour red to make certain things to
stand out as we are most attracted to red.
